Output 66a895646a72eab33c256ad1a077db3eb1517379221bbf24ea922f3a7e7bbede:0
- value
- 1013633
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f692e770438501aff1c28d0468ca380dd7c9e94
- address
- bc1qha5juacy8pgp4lcu9rgydr9rsrwhe855up5xf7
- transaction
- 66a895646a72eab33c256ad1a077db3eb1517379221bbf24ea922f3a7e7bbede
- spent
- true